First, a brief introduction to his background. Sam Friedman was born in 1984 in Oneonta, New York. He studied illustration and typography at the Pratt Art Institute, an art college in New York City, and after graduating, he worked at various jobs before becoming the studio manager at KAWS. Later, he began working independently, and has held exhibitions in the United States, Europe, Asia, and other parts of the world.

Known for his style of smooth, flowing, delicate lines and colorful gradations, he has created many abstract works that reflect the organic elements and textures found in the natural world. Inspired by the landscape of upstate New York, where he lives and works, he continues to paint these images on canvas with an approach that is constantly being updated.
